Transaction fb540e666a63bf1bb0994a6b60c28d511668318232fe9caf8fd4abb72ab43f31

1 Input
2 Outputs
  • fb540e666a63bf1bb0994a6b60c28d511668318232fe9caf8fd4abb72ab43f31:0
  • value  25520277
    address  1HuCzQJXtGuE32RhW2k4uhJXXYx4brAot6
  • fb540e666a63bf1bb0994a6b60c28d511668318232fe9caf8fd4abb72ab43f31:1
  • value  706312600
    address  183umUxFrwz4k1G47AsX1kaRLtvthLjt49